Korean football will challenge Asia’s top in 64 years at the 2023 Asian Football Confederation (AFC) Asian Cup. In the draw for the tournament held in Doha, Qatar on the 11th (Korean time), Korea, ranked 27th in the FIFA rankings, was placed in Group E along with Jordan (84th), Bahrain (85th) and Malaysia (138th). .
Qatar, which obtained the hosting rights returned by China due to the novel coronavirus infection (Corona 19) pandemic, will avoid the harsh heat and hold the tournament from January 13 (opening match) to February 11 (final match) next year instead of originally scheduled July. did. According to the schedule confirmed by the AFC, Korea will play the first group match against Bahrain at Jasim Bin Hamad Stadium on January 15 next year, the second match against Jordan at Altuma Stadium on the 20th, and Malaysia at Abdullah Bin Khalifa Stadium on the 25th. and play the 3rd game.

One thing to note is the kickoff time. All three group stage matches will start at 2:30 p.m. local time. It is 8:30 pm in Korea time, and it can be a considerable burden for the players. January and February in Qatar are winter, but daytime temperatures often exceed 33 degrees Celsius.

If they reach the round of 16 with 1st place in the group as hoped, they will face the 2nd place in Group D, which belongs to Japan, on January 31 next year, followed by a quarterfinal match at Aljanub Stadium on February 3rd. These, too, all kick off at 2:30 p.m. local time. Considering that at the 2022 World Cup in Qatar, Korea played matches at 4:00 pm (against Uruguay and Ghana), 6:00 pm (against Portugal), and 10:00 pm (against Brazil), the Asian Cup faced more intense heat. .
